General Conditions: All mechanical equipment and other equipment on the <br />building shall be screened from view from adjacent public streets, and private properties. Loading <br />and trash areas shall be screened from view from the adjacent streets and properties. <br />All on-site vehicular and pedestrian routes shall be coordinated with Agency and City <br />public improvements and circulation plans and shall be subject to approval by the City's Traffic <br />Engineer. <br />All on-site utilities shall be installed underground. Utility and related mechanical <br />equipment shall be installed underground or screened from public view. <br />The Developer shall apply to and receive approvals from the City and the Agency for <br />the project's site design and elevations as required by any and all applicable City codes and <br />regulations and the Agreement. <br />D. General Requirements. <br />The Developer shall comply with the following general requirements: <br />1. The Developer shall devote the property to the uses, restrictions and <br />covenants specified in the Agreement. <br />2. The Developer shall grant and permit all necessary utility easements and <br />rights for the development of the Property and the improvement of the Adjacent City Property, <br />including sanitary sewer, storm drains, water, electrical power, telephone, natural gas, CATV, and <br />any other utility easements. <br />3. Installation of all public improvements required in connection with the <br />entitlements for the Developer Improvements, and payment of all fees imposed by public agencies in <br />connection with the provision of the Developer Improvements (excepting only that the payment of <br />building fees for Phase 2 Improvements shall not be required unless and until the Developer <br />undertakes the Phase 2 Improvements). <br />4.
